Budget Procedures
The set of processes and guidelines a business or organization follows to create, implement, and monitor its budget.
Budget Schedule
A detailed plan that outlines a company's financial and operational goals over a specific period, often including expected revenues, expenses, and cash flows.
Budget Manual
A comprehensive guideline document for the preparation of budgets, detailing procedures, and responsibilities.
Internal Control
The processes and procedures implemented by an organization to ensure the integrity of financial and accounting information, promote accountability, and prevent fraud.
